certbot.display.ops module¶
Contains UI methods for LE user operations.
- certbot.display.ops.get_email(invalid: bool = False, optional: bool = True) str[source]¶
 Prompt for valid email address.
- Parameters:
 invalid (bool) – True if an invalid address was provided by the user
optional (bool) – True if the user can use –register-unsafely-without-email to avoid providing an e-mail
- Returns:
 e-mail address
- Return type:
 str
- Raises:
 errors.Error – if the user cancels

- certbot.display.ops.choose_values(values: List[str], question: Optional[str] = None) List[str][source]¶
 Display screen to let user pick one or multiple values from the provided list.
- Parameters:
 values (list) – Values to select from
question (str) – Question to ask to user while choosing values
- Returns:
 List of selected values
- Return type:
 list
- certbot.display.ops.choose_names(installer: Optional[Installer], question: Optional[str] = None) List[str][source]¶
 Display screen to select domains to validate.
- Parameters:
 installer (
certbot.interfaces.Installer) – An installer objectquestion (str) – Overriding default question to ask the user if asked to choose from domain names.
- Returns:
 List of selected names
- Return type:
 listofstr

- certbot.display.ops.report_executed_command(command_name: str, returncode: int, stdout: str, stderr: str) None[source]¶
 Display a message describing the success or failure of an executed process (e.g. hook).
- Parameters:
 command_name (str) – Human-readable description of the executed command
returncode (int) – The exit code of the executed command
stdout (str) – The stdout output of the executed command
stderr (str) – The stderr output of the executed command
- certbot.display.ops.validated_input(validator: Callable[[str], Any], *args: Any, **kwargs: Any) Tuple[str, str][source]¶
 Like
input_text, but with validation.- Parameters:
 validator (callable) – A method which will be called on the supplied input. If the method raises an
errors.Error, its text will be displayed and the user will be re-prompted.*args (list) – Arguments to be passed to
input_text.**kwargs (dict) – Arguments to be passed to
input_text.
- Returns:
 as
input_text- Return type:
 tuple
